Residential treatment programs are a longer-term treatment program (lasting
3-12 months or more) for children and adolescents with long-standing behavioral
health problems. The programs offer physician-led, multi-disciplinary treatment
teams that addresses overall medical, psychiatric, social and academic needs
of the child. RTC programs offer a balance of therapies and activities in a
safe, structured setting.
Fox Run's 50-bed Residential Treatment Center (RTC) is an intense, individualized
treatment program. The RTC provides a secure environment, programming and educational
services to males and females, children and adolescents, ages 5-17. The program
is designed to help youth learn new ways to manage themselves and situations.
In addition to the RTC, Fox Run has recently opened the Visions Program for dually diagnosed MH/MR males and females ages 12-17
with an IQ between 50 and 70.
